hey just FYI: if someone messages you on discord asking you to test a game they're making for a class by downloading a running an exe, and this isn't completely 100% expected based on having seen them in real life and they said "I'm making a game for class and I'd like you to test it" to your face, their account has been hacked and it's a scam.

Folks, if someone in the US wants to study a group of people with a a certain condition, they go to an IRB to get permission. They have to decide if the research will use identifiable information. If the data contain identifiers, you essentially always have to get permission from each and every patient, and that permission has to be specific to the exact use of their data.
You don’t “make a registry” of everyone with a disease. Bad people do that. Nazis. Insurance execs. Bad people.
